The Singapore Tourism Board (STB) will partner Temasek Holdings to create a large-scale nature project in the Mandai precinct, the Miniustry of Trade and Industry (MTI) announced in a press release on Wednesday (Jan 14).

Temasek is the majority shareholder of Wildlife Reserves Singapore (WRS), which operates the existing stable of Mandai attractions and Jurong Bird Park. It submitted a “compelling proposal to build on their existing attractions to shape Mandai into a leading nature destination in Asia”, said MTI.

Mr S Iswaran, Minister in the Prime Minister’s Office and Second Minister for Home Affairs and Trade and Industry, said: "Temasek’s concept builds on and significantly enhances the current WRS attractions in Mandai. The proposal is sensitive to the area’s unique environment, while including exciting ideas and developments that will bring benefits to both Singaporeans and tourists.

"As a major stakeholder in Mandai, Temasek appreciates its uniqueness and importance to Singapore. With the expertise and experience it has gained from WRS, and its international network, Temasek will be able to create outstanding content for a world-class development in Mandai. The Government looks forward to working with Temasek to bring this project to fruition," he added.

The planned development of Mandai was first announced by Prime Minister Lee Hsien Loong in September last year. When completed, the precinct outside the Nature Reserves will comprise about 120 hectares, MTI said.

This will include the development of new attractions that will be integrated with the existing Singapore Zoo, Night Safari and River Safari. A multi-agency collaboration will guide Mandai’s development, according to MTI.  Temasek will be commissioning a comprehensive Environmental Impact Assessment (EIA), with guidance from the National Parks Board.
